European Commission puts Article 50 transparency duties into effect
The European Commission put Article 50’s transparency duties into effect on August 2.
That resolves part of the choice between voluntary publisher disclosure and a shared legal floor, with the floor now carrying more weight. Enforcement still decides the reader’s experience. Commission notices naming news deployers by August 2027 would show the rule has teeth; a year without one would send me back toward disclosure as house style.
